Aruba Morning Snorkel Sail

Embark on a half-day sail and snorkel adventure in Aruba’s crystal clear sea. Explore shipwrecks, vibrant coral reefs, and enjoy a delicious lunch on a spacious catamaran.

Duration: 4 hours
Cancellation: 24 hours
Highlights
  • The Antilla - Snorkel and explore a wreck!
  • Arashi Beach - Enjoy time on the beach
  • De Palm Pier - See Aruba from a new perspective, aboard the spacious Palm Pleasure, a 70-foot-long and 40-foot-wide catamaran. You will get treated to 3 snorkel stops, open bar, lunch and beautiful views.
  • Boca Cataavlina - Enjoy a beautiful time on the catamaran

Location
De Palm Pier
J.E. Irausquin Boulevard
Walk down the walkway between the Hilton and RIU Palace. You will see the Coconuts Gift Shop on De Palm Pier. Enter the Coconuts Store and go to the counter to check-in for your activity. Check-in for the activity is 30 minutes before the activity start time.

The best experience - I like to write reviews as honestly as possible because I rely on them when I’m booking things, so here’s my honest review. This tour was everything and more! Most places that advertise “included drinks and food” usually mean watered-down drinks, a small selection, and food that’s just okay. But here, the drinks really were unlimited, the food was fresh and flavorful, and the overall vibe was amazing. We made three stops: the first at a 60ft shipwreck, which was incredible to see, and two shallower spots around 10ft where you could get a close look at the marine life. The highlight for me was getting to swim near sea turtles, such a cool experience! Cesar was also a huge part of what made the tour so fun. He kept the energy high, made sure everyone was comfortable, and created an environment where you could really enjoy yourself! The music was a great selection that caters to all people which we appreciated! If you’re debating whether or not to book, I can honestly say this is one experience worth it.
